            Yes, all five favorites actually... and they not only covered, but pretty much went wire to wire in their respective victories.

            Notre Dame won by 16
            Mississippi won by 28
            Stanford won by 29
            Michigan won by 34
            Tennessee won by 39

            So our average margin of victory amongst our New Year's Day bowls is 29 points. That's pretty ridiculous.

            And the preceding bowls didn't fare much better.

                                      The point that I don't understand from Penn State backers is "Richt is fired and Georgia doesn't have a coach. Therefore they will shit the bed" WTF? Their coach is at the game and even gave them a pep talk. These guys are playing for their jobs next year. It's a new coach and they want to show him they want to start. It's much different if a coach is fired and they don't have anyone lined up to take over. That's when teams tend to lay down. But when their new coach is there at the game and it's a home crowd, you better believe they're going to gonna play their ass off.

                                                  Big trend this bowl season has been the late money sharps are killing it. I've watched the line 15 minutes before kickoff, and whereever it goes, it goes on the winner. Late money on Stanford and Ole Miss last night. Went on Arkansas today. Went on Houston NYE. Went on Michigan yesterday. Went on Tennessee. Went on Oregon today. Was on Wisconsin late the other night. Was on Louisville and Miss. State. An amazing trend.
